Technology‑Driven Swing Analysis

Get more out of every session with video playback, swing‑path tracking and real‑time data. Some batting cages in Westchester, NY integrate high‑speed cameras and smart sensors to highlight bat angle, exit velocity and launch angle—empowering you with insights usually reserved for elite programs.

How do I book a cage session?

Most venues offer online booking via their websites or apps. You can also call ahead to reserve your preferred time slot.
